Tsinghua Quantum Spin-Off Liangyi Wanxiang Closes Series A to Build First Atomic Computer
Liangyi Wanxiang, a neutral-atom quantum computing spin-off from Tsinghua University, has raised over RMB 100 million (≈$14 million) in a Series A round co-led by state-backed and private investors. The company plans to ship its first-generation atomic quantum computer by spring 2027.

Red Bear AI has closed a RMB 210 million (≈$29.4 million) Series A at a post-money valuation exceeding RMB 1.5 billion (≈$210 million), backed by Huayu Ventures for the fourth consecutive time. The company is building a 'memory science + multi-modal large model' stack to make AI functional in the physical world — and it's already generating serious revenue.

Kepler Robotics has closed a 100 million yuan (≈$14 million) A++ round led by SAIF Partners, signalling a deliberate strategic shift from hardware deployment to data and model infrastructure. The move positions Kepler as a full-stack embodied intelligence company targeting industrial humanoid applications — and raises pointed questions for European players still debating whether to build or buy.
